"defect" Definition
- a fault in something or in the way it has been made that means that it is not perfect
- (sometimes offensive) a physical problem with part of somebody’s body or the way that it works Some people dislike the use of defect to refer to a physical problem, as they think it suggests that a person is not as good as other people.
